Everyone was very busy today checking out all the different things to do in all the classrooms.
In the large motor room this morning and afternoon we played popcorn with the parachute and took turns running under it. In the Discovery/Walnut room the children enjoyed hammering golf tees into the pumpkins.
The children are also interested in the birds that we have in the discovery room. We put birdseed into the dry sensory table for them to scoop and use funnels with.
In the Art/Oak room we still have the shaving cream but we added some powdered paint to it to give it some color! Painting also seemed to be a hit today. The children were sketching things and using shades of gray, black and white to paint the sketches. In the Construction/Maple room children were building a structure with different blocks. A few children started it and eventually more children chipped in to help stack the blocks.
In the Pine room today we added money, credit cards, and checks to the farmers market for the children to use. They seemed to enjoy writing out checks and being able to use different forms of payment in the farmers market.
